Product Overview
With the Thermo Scientific™ Niton™ XL5e handheld XRF analyzer, elemental analysis is performed rapidly and accurately. This advanced instrument provides strong detection performance and delivers reliable results in minimal time.
Built with superior ergonomics for extended use, the analyzer features modern software for streamlined reporting and integrated Wi-Fi for enhanced connectivity.
Key Features
- 5 W X-ray tube
- Integrated fan for thermal management
- Lightweight design (2.8 lbs / 1.3 kg)
- Built-in micro camera
- Bluetooth and Wi-Fi connectivity
- Hot swap battery
- Color touchscreen display
- Password-protected security
- IP54 certified (dust- and splash-resistant)

Applications
- Verification of metals and alloys during manufacturing processes
- Real-time geochemical testing for mineral exploration
- Non-destructive on-site inspections for positive material identification
- Point-and-shoot material sorting in scrap recycling operations
- On-site screening of contaminated soils for heavy metals
Available Modes
- General Metals
- Mining
- Light Metal Quick Sort (Scrap)
- Soil
- Plastics

Specifications
Source: Thermo Fisher Scientific – Handheld Elemental & Radiation Detection
| . |
| Certifications/Compliance |
CE, RoHS, FCC, Industry Canada, Safety to IEC 61010-1:2010 |
| Data Entry |
Touchscreen keyboard, user-customizable data entry, optional wireless remote barcode reader |
| Data Storage |
512 MB internal system memory / 16 GB industrial grade storage; Stores approximately 130,000 readings with spectra |
| Data Transfer |
WiFi, USB-C |
| Dimensions (L × W × H) |
9.54 × 8.19 × 2.67 in (242.56 × 208.17 × 67.90 mm) |
| Display Type |
Fixed, color, resistive touchscreen display |
| Global Positioning System |
Supported via optional external GPS (via Bluetooth) |
| IP Rating |
IP54 |
| Languages |
English, Chinese, Spanish, Portuguese, Russian, Japanese, German, Korean, French, Turkish, Italian |
| Libraries |
Default alloy libraries based on SAE, AISI, ASTM, AA, DIN, GB standards; Users may create, clone, and edit libraries |
| Licensing |
Varies by region. Contact your local distributor. |
| Operating Environment |
Temperature: -10 °C to 50 °C, Humidity: 10 % to 90 % relative humidity non-condensing |
| Operating System |
Linux |
| Optional Accessories |
Portable test stand, Mini test stand, Hotwork stand-off, Soil guard, Bluetooth printer |
| Power Consumption |
12 V lithium-ion battery, or 12 V DC, 3A, 3.6 W power supply; Hot swap functionality |
| Security Features |
Password-protected user security |
| Software |
NitonConnect PC software |
| Spot Size |
8 mm collimation |
| Standard Accessories |
Locking shielded carrying case, Two (2) lithium-ion battery packs, One (1) 110/220 VAC battery charger/AC adapter, Check samples, Safety lanyard, PC connection cable (USB) |
| System Details |
Built-in standardization and health check verify the system integrity |
| Weight (English) |
2.8 lbs with battery |
| Weight (Metric) |
1.3 kg with battery |
| X-Ray Source Type |
Ag anode (6-50 kV, 0-500 µA, 5 W max) |
| Applications |
Elemental analysis for: metals and alloys, geological and soil samples, plastics |
| Tube Voltage |
50 kV |
